Question 376797: Write Logb(that is base b)x^3y^2/z(that is a fraction) in terms of the logarithms of x, y, and z.

There are three properties of logarithms which can be used to manipulate arguments of logarithms:
Since your argument is a fraction/division, we willstart by using the second property to split the numerator and denominator into their own logarithms:

Next we can use the first property on the first logarithm, since its argument is a product:

And last we can use the third property on the first two logarithms, since their arguments have exponents:

This expression is equivalent to the original expression and it it expressed in terms of the base b logarithms of x, y and z.
